          Of the more than three hundred pressure points on the human body, only
          approx. twenty are used, as they are the safest, most practical and easily
          accessible.  These  points  have  been  tactically,  medically,  and  legally,
          researched, allowing officers to use a safer, lower level of force.

          The use of pressure points is broken down into two distinctive systems:
          1) The nerve motor points of the head and neck. Large sensory nerves
          which are close to the surface of the skin are targeted. Sensory nerves

          2) The nerve motor points of the arms and legs. These were researched
          initially as a safer method of baton use.  Instead of striking joints, which     Rookie of the Month
          most often would cause injury. These areas are surrounded by muscle
          mass and saturated with effector nerve tissue, which receives messages
